His father died age 29, 3 weeks before Andrew was born in 1767 -- no one knows exactly where because his mother had to travel for the burial in unsurveyed territory. During the Revolutionary War his older brother died from heat exhaustion after a battle. Andrew and the other remaining brother then served in the war as couriers & were captured by the British in 1781. In captivity, Andrew refused to clean the boots of a British officer & the officer slashed him with a sword, permanently scarring his left hand and head. The brothers contracted smallpox and nearly starved to death in captivity. The brother died just after his release was promised. Andrew's mother volunteered to nurse prisoners of war on board cholera ships, and she died from cholera and was buried in an unmarked grave a few months later. Thus Andrew was an orphan at age 14.
